Charles was the son of Levi Woodson Fisher and Mary Elizabeth Hatfield Fisher. He settled in the Victoria area after moving to Texas with his father from Colorado. While serving in the U. S. Navy during WWII he married a lady, whose name is unknown, in England. They had no children. She was later killed in London during a German air raid. After the war, Charles returned to Pasadena where he worked as a sign painter. He never remarried.
